The Departed
As with any long-running show, cast changes are inevitable, and Euphoria is no exception. The five-year gap between seasons has seen some beloved characters bid farewell. Barbie Ferreira, who portrayed the iconic Kat, announced her emotional departure in 2022, citing the need to avoid the 'fat best friend' trope. Storm Reid, who played Gia, also exited due to scheduling conflicts, focusing on her education and production ventures. And in a tragic turn of events, Angus Cloud, who brought Fez to life, passed away in 2023, leaving a void in the cast and the hearts of fans.
Other notable exits include Austin Abrams (Ethan), Nika King (Rue and Gia's mum), and Algee Smith, whose character Chris had a reduced presence in season two.
The New Blood
While we bid farewell to some, we welcome a staggering 18 new cast members, each shrouded in secrecy. The legendary Sharon Stone confirmed her involvement, praising the show's creator, Sam Levinson. She's joined by Natasha Lyonne, Eli Roth, Rosalía, Danielle Deadwyler, Sam Trammel, and the internet sensation Trisha Paytas, whose character promises chaos.
The Core Remains
Amidst the newcomers, the core cast remains intact. Zendaya returns as the enigmatic Rue, alongside Sydney Sweeney (Cassie), Jacob Elordi (Nate), Alexa Demi (Maddy), Hunter Schafer (Jules), Maude Apatow (Lexi), Dominic Fike (Elliot), and Colman Domingo (Ali). Martha Kelly and Eric Dane reprise their roles as Laurie and Cal, respectively, with Dane's return being particularly poignant after his ALS diagnosis.
